Three hosts explore what it takes for Black women to make Black men feel emotionally safe—covering expectations of toughness, the need for vulnerability, and the importance of balanced support.
They share poll results, personal stories, and practical strategies like emotional check-ins, mutual accountability, and male support networks to build healthier, more connected relationships.
